Storage Capacity Requirements

Choosing the right storage capacity for your chest freezer is essential, especially since options range from 2.0 to 7.0 cubic feet. If you have a large family or engage in meal prep, a freezer with 5.0 to 5.1 cubic feet is ideal, offering ample space for meats and meals. For those in compact living spaces, smaller models between 2.0 to 3.5 cubic feet can provide extra storage without consuming too much room. Think about your future needs; if you plan to buy in bulk or store seasonal harvests, a larger capacity may be beneficial. Finally, consider internal organization features like removable baskets to enhance storage efficiency and help you easily access smaller items.

Energy Efficiency Ratings

Energy efficiency ratings are essential to evaluate as they directly impact your electricity bills and the environment. Look for the Energy Star label on chest freezers, which indicates compliance with energ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ency. The average energy consumption for these units ranges from 200 to 400 kWh annually, influenced by size, features, and how you use them. Opting for a model with a higher energy efficiency rating can save you $50 or more each year. Energy-efficient freezers often incorporate advanced insulation and compressor technology to minimize energy use while ensuring peak freezing. Additionally, maintaining your freezer, like cleaning coils and checking door seals, can further boost its energy ef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Much Energy Do Chest Freezers Typically Consume?

Chest freezers typically consume between 200 to 400 kilowatt-hours annually, depending on size and efficiency. You can check the Energy Star rating for more specific details on energy usage and potential savings.

Can Chest Freezers Operate in Garage or Outdoor Settings?

Yes, chest freezers can operate in garages or outdoor settings, but make certain they’re rated for such environments. Keep them away from extreme temperatures to maintain efficiency and prevent potential damage to the unit.

What Is the Average Lifespan of a Chest Freezer?

A chest freezer typically lasts around 15 to 20 years with proper care. Regular maintenance and keeping it in ideal conditions can help you maximize its lifespan and guarantee reliable performance for your food storage needs.

How Do I Properly Maintain and Clean My Chest Freezer?

To maintain and clean your chest freezer, unplug it, remove food, and wipe surfaces with a solution of warm water and mild detergent. Rinse, dry thoroughly, and check the seals for any wear or damage.

Are Chest Freezers Noisy During Operation?

Chest freezers can be noisy during operation, but the noise levels vary by model. You might notice humming or clicking sounds, but they shouldn’t be overly disruptive. Regular maintenance can help minimize any excessive noise.
